Check and Refresh Mailbox Counters
Feature Server release 8.1.201.80 includes these two python scripts:
- refreshMailboxCounters.py — Renews or resets mailbox counters.
- getAllMailboxCountersInfo.py — Checks mailbox counters.
Follow these steps:
- Run getAllMailboxCountersInfo.py to identify mailboxes having invalid counters.
- a.These mailboxes will be marked with !!! in the script output log.
- For example: Mailbox: 86025: Read value: '-1/0 (0/0)'; Calculated value: '0/0 (0/0)'; !!!
- Create the input file listing all mailboxes having invalid counters.
- Run refreshMailboxCounters.py using the input file created.
Note: Genesys recommends no voicemail activity on the affected mailboxes only, when running the scripts.

Deploy the python scripts
- On the master Feature Server instance, copy the jython-2.7b1.jar file...
from FS installation path\work\jetty-x.x.x.x-pppp-fs.war-_fs-any-\webapp\WEB-INF\lib
to FS installation path\python\util - Open the console and navigate to FS installation path\python\util, which contains the scripts.
- Enter the appropriate command to set the JYTHONPATH...
Windows
set JYTHONPATH=FS installation path\python
Linux
export JYTHONPATH=FS installation path/python
Run the python scripts
The following python scripts save data, such as User roles, User Voicemail Profiles assignments, and User Group Voicemail Profiles assignments, that are not related to or synchronized with Configuration Server.
Each script creates a csv file that you can analyze, edit as needed, and use as the input data for the scripts restoring the data not contained in Configuration Server.
Use this command line format to run each script:
java -jar jython-2.7b1.jar scriptname.py script input parameters

Refresh Mailbox Counters
- Verify that:
- Your Cassandra database is backed up. See [Documentation:FS:Admin:cassback Backing Up and Restoring Cassandra Data].
- All Feature Servers are up and running.
- There is no voicemail activity (no one can deposit, read, or listen to voicemail).
- Create a .csv file which has the list of mailboxes that needs to be refreshed.
- Run the Python script refreshMailboxcounters.py.
The content of the file mailboxeIdsInput.csv should be in this format:
4909045 4909185 4909005 4909889
Sample Command Line
java -jar jython-2.7b1.jar refreshMailboxCounters.py -H localhost -p 9160 -i ./mailboxeIdsInput.csv -o ./refreshMailboxCounters.log
Check Mailbox Counters
- Verify that:
- All Feature Servers are up and running.
- There is no voicemail activity (no one can deposit, read, or listen to voicemail).
- Run getAllMailboxCountersInfo.py.
Sample Command Line
java -jar jython-2.7b1.jar getAllMailboxCountersInfo.py -H localhost -p 9160 -o ./getAllMailboxCountersInfo.log
